ONE OF THE BEST YA FICTION IN 2015. 5 to 1 by Holly Bodger @HollyBodger


5 to 1
by Holly Bodger
Genre: YA Fiction
Publisher: Knopf BFYR

Published on May 12th 2015


Synopsis:

In the year 2054, after decades of gender selection, India now has a ratio of five boys for every girl, making women an incredibly valuable commodity. Tired of marrying off their daughters to the highest bidder and determined to finally make marriage fair, the women who form the country of Koyanagar have instituted a series of tests so that every boy has the chance to win a wife.

Sudasa doesn’t want to be a wife, and Kiran, a boy forced to compete in the test to become her husband, has other plans as well. Sudasa’s family wants nothing more than for their daughter to do the right thing and pick a husband who will keep her comfortable—and caged. Kiran’s family wants him to escape by failing the tests. As the tests advance, Sudasa and Kiran thwart each other at every turn until they slowly realize that they just might want the same thing.

This beautiful, unique novel is told from alternating points of view—Sudasa’s in verse and Kiran’s in prose—allowing readers to experience both characters’ pain and their brave struggle for hope.

I am absorbed in this story because it's not the usual dystopian book you'll see sitting in everyone's shelves or the bookstore's. It fiddles with the gender inequality in India that could be also a representation of the world's. While most of the fiction books out today feature sexism, typically against women, this book had its center on feminism. And that makes this book uniquely gripping! It is indeed, a beauty!

The writing both in prose and in verse are absolutely beautiful and engaging! It gives variance and personality to the main characters. It makes the Point-Of-View alteration flawless and nice. It is indeed, a beauty!

The book cover is so pretty; It has the touch of diversity. Unique, Intriguing, and Different. It is indeed, a beauty!

This book has No Romance in it but the chemistry between Sudasa and Kiran is so natural and real; it's making me anticipate everything about them. The characters are all written ideally. Loving and brave, ones that should be the idols people must look up to. The are adorable and strong. Sudasa's might be the dominant voice in this book and there are quite limited background told about Kiran, still it does not affect how I see 5 to 1. It is still, a beauty!
